Fresh off his festival appearance, Travis Scott returns. This time, it's with his new partner Hiroshi Fujiwara of fragment design, as the two collaborators unveil a comedic spot. In the short clip, Travis and Hiroshi promote the upcoming Travis Scott x fragment x Air Jordan 1 High OG "Military Blue", which drops on 29 July.

For months, the upcoming Jordan has been one of the best shoe collaborations of 2021, and in just a few hours, it will finally be here. If you don't know the details on the sneaker yet, you should take a look here.

The video on Instagram lasts 55 seconds and starts with Hiroshi Fujiwara walking through what appears to be Japanese streets in the sneakers. The designer then enters a phone box, after which the image switches to Travis Scott, who braves the stormy weather and also enters a phone box. Finally, he takes the call from Fujiwara. They have a short conversation that ends with Hiroshi Fujiwara advising Scott to "use a fragment of his imagination," an allusion to their upcoming project. After that, the phone call also ends with an excited Travis Scott getting into his styled BMW M3 E30.   https://www.instagram.com/p/CR4mAbtDsXJ/
